Name of the Client:
Tata Steel Limited
- The scheme has considered a system to recover
- Approx.1450 Cu-M/hr(7.5 MGD)(1200 CU-M/hr from sunsungharia Nallah & 150 Cu-M/hr from Garam Nallah) out of a total of 2050 Cu-M available. A settling tank/collection Tank is provided at both the locations and independently connected through pipe lines to B.H. #2 Tunnel for return of recovered water to lower cooling pond.
- The scope of work envisages all aspects of engineering & project work including complete design & engineering, project management, procurement of all supply items including placement of order, inspection of supplies, site execution, and erection & commissioning of system. JUSCO has worked here as a EPC contractor.
Brief description of the Project:
The Project comprises of following components to be constructed by JUSCO
- Waste water recovery system
- Route survey, Design & preparation of construction drawings
- Procurement of materials
- External Painting of pipe – 2.1 K.M
- Structural Steel Fabrication & Erection – 21 MT
- Laying & erection of pipe (500 & 300nb) – 2.2 KM
- Testing & Commissioning
- Civil work involve intake,settling tank, M.C.C. Room, Pump house & pipeline support
- Electrical & instrumentation work Like installation & commissioning of MCC PANEL, PLC PANEL, FLOW METER LEVEL SENSOR ETC.
- This plant is fully automated.
Details of Jusco’s Construction Contract:
Contract Value: 6.74 Cr
Contract Duration: 16 months
Date of Completion: Completed 10.03.2009 |
